You will serve as a PERSONAL & PROFESSIONAL DEVELOPMENT TECHNICIAN in the MARINE CORPS COMMUNITY SERVICES of MARINE CORPS BASE QUANTICO.

Duties

You will administer relocation services to include sponsorship coordinator, settling in services and Permanent Change of Station (PCS) classes. You will provide oversight of the installation sponsorship program and the maintenance of the Defense Information System. You will be responsible for managing the clerical and administrative functions within the MandFP Branch as needed. You will edit, reformat, transmit and receives drafts of documents and correspondence using standard Microsoft Office software. You will ensure adequate facility and program supplies and ensures proper equipment is available to meet center needs. You will serves as the PandPD Representative to the PandPD Program managers. You will administer and coordinate the Retired Activities program to provide services unique to retirees and the families. You will respond to routine and non-technical requests for information such as the status of reports, duty status of personnel, suspense dates for matters requiring compliance and similar information readily available.

  • Generally, current federal employees applying for GS jobs must serve at least one year at the next lower grade level. This requirement is called time-in-grade. Time-in-grade requirements must be met by the closing date of this announcement.
  • Within the Department of Defense (DoD), the appointment of retired military members within 180 days immediately following retirement date to a civilian position is subject to the provisions of 5 United States Code 3326.
